Manuscript DS, in French, signed “Bonaparte,” one page, 8 x 12.5, December 3, 1798. Order issued to the Chief Ordnance Officer. In full (translated): “Please issue an additional 200 pairs of shoes to the Maltese Legion and have 400 caps and 400 shirts delivered to them tomorrow during the course of the day.” Signed at the conclusion by Napoleon as Commanding General of the Army of Egypt. Intersecting folds, one through a single letter of signature, creasing and wax remnants to top corners, pencil notation under date, and some ink toning along top edge, otherwise fine condition.
